Output 4809acd637bc7bf02687e542b3804e7af2ac0b5e13f5c7b5c7ebcedb19ca5c3a:2

value
23511046
script pubkey
OP_0 OP_PUSHBYTES_20 88f5102d83404cb35befa330b67381454164e754
address
bc1q3r63qtvrgpxtxkl05vctvuupg4qkfe65uszldt
transaction
4809acd637bc7bf02687e542b3804e7af2ac0b5e13f5c7b5c7ebcedb19ca5c3a
confirmations
29853
spent
true